
Am I responsible for my grandmother medical bills visiting me from a different country.
My grandmother-in-law came to US for a short visit on a visitor visa for tourism. Due to some complications we had to take her to hospital in emergency. She was in hospital for 13 days & had a pacemaker put in. My granny has left the country & went back to her home. I am being bombarded by her medical bills. She had international insurance but the coverage amount has been exceeded, the hospital had all insurance info. I am getting phone calls, letters, bills in her name @ my address. What should I do ?, am I liable to pay those bills.? I have a copy of her insurance card. Should I start calling everybody & give them her insurance card...or just tell them that she has left the country.
